wring

n.
1.a twisting squeeze wring v.
1.twist and press out of shape
2.twist and compress, as if in pain or anguish
3.obtain by coercion or intimidation
4.twist, squeeze, or compress in order to extract liquid

  • Idiom of the Day

    trade on (something)
    to use a fact or a situation to one's advantage
    The woman trades on her beauty and never works very hard.
